I found this history on the site:
**1984 ** Polish National Catholic Church begins dialogue
with the Roman Catholic Church – hopes to end animosity
between the two Churches and live in harmony with mutual
respect for each others traditions, teachings and practices.
**2005 ** Prime Bishop Nemkovich attends the funeral of Pope John Paul II at St. Peter’s
Basilica in Vatican City. He is greeted by Cardinal Joseph Ratzinger and
Cardinal Walter Kasper while in Rome.

It comes from Sede Vacante - literally “empty chair” - and refers to the belief that the current Church is so far removed from orthodoxy that the Pope is not “really” the Pope, and thus the Chair of Peter is vacant. Some schismatics use this line of reasoning to argue that they, and not the Church, are the true heirs of the Apostles.
